Subject: Poser 6 How Do I...


Hailo ( ) posted Fri, 29 April 2005 at 11:57 PM · edited Sat, 08 February 2025 at 11:09 AM

Add all the content I purchased with Poser 5 to Poser 6?


Francemi ( ) posted Sat, 30 April 2005 at 12:26 AM

The easiest way is to link the Poser 5 runtime in Poser 6. If you don't know how, either search the forum (I saw that recently) or wait till someone can explain to you in English. I know exactly how to do it but I don't think I could explain correctly. Sorry.

France, Proud Owner of

KCTC Freebies  


DIMENSION_X ( ) posted Sat, 30 April 2005 at 2:17 AM

The easiest way is to copy the entire contents of the P5 runtime (folder) into within P6 runtime (folder). Dont forget to load P6 Content library afterwards to fix a few content faults such as P6 will delete Kozubaru Hair obj files. Have fun
